Resolving Capacity Barriers in Small Kitchens
Although small kitchens can pose significant storage challenges, creative approaches can optimize every inch of space. Using vertical areas is crucial; wall-mounted shelves and cabinets can hold cookware and utensils, clearing counter space. metal strips for knives and spice jars can also organize surfaces while keeping essential items within reach. Additionally, incorporating versatile pieces, such as an island with built-in storage, improves both utility and organization.
The interior of cabinet doors can be utilized for hanging pot lids or small baskets, generating additional storage without taking up valuable floor space. Better enhancement of storage is achievable through drawer dividers that keep utensils organized and accessible.
Even incorporating pull-out shelves can convert deep cabinets into readily available areas. By employing these approaches, small kitchens can turn into more practical and effective, allowing for a seamless cooking process without the constraints of limited space.

Smart Organization Strategies
Maximizing kitchen space demands innovative smart storage solutions that enhance both functionality and aesthetics. Adding pull-out cabinets and drawers allows for easy access to pots and pans, while wall-based storage solutions, such as wall-mounted shelves, make use of otherwise wasted space. Additionally, drawer dividers help arrange utensils, ensuring items are readily available. Using corner cabinets with lazy Susans or pull-out mechanisms can eliminate dead zones, establishing more usable area. Magnetic strips for knives and spice racks mounted on walls offer convenient retrieval while keeping counters clutter-free. By integrating these smart solutions, homeowners can create a kitchen that is not only visually appealing but also highly efficient, allowing for a smooth culinary workflow.
Efficient Work Triangle
Building an efficient kitchen transcends smart storage solutions; the layout represents an important function in functionality. Central to this design is the triangular cooking zone, which unites the three essential points: the stove, sink, and refrigerator. This triangular organization minimizes movement and boosts workflow, facilitating for quick meal creation. Ideally, each part of the triangle should be between 4 to 9 feet, creating a sense of balance that prevents congestion. Moreover, the triangle should not be hindered by cabinets or islands, confirming easy access to all areas. By prioritizing the work triangle in kitchen design, homeowners can optimize their cooking space, making it not only effective but also enjoyable to use.

Timeless Materials and Treatments for Your Kitchen
Timeless materials and finishes can transform a kitchen into a space that balances functionality with lasting beauty. Natural stone, such as granite or marble, persists as a popular choice for countertops due to its durability and unique patterns, ensuring no two kitchens look alike. Classic subway tiles present as a versatile backsplash option, imparting a clean, elegant aesthetic that complements various design styles.
For cabinet construction, solid wood delivers both strength and warmth, while painted surfaces can offer a modern touch. Stainless steel appliances not only improve functionality but also lend a sophisticated, streamlined appearance.
For floor decisions, porcelain tile combined with hardwood are fantastic options, displaying both resilience and ageless style. Employing these materials can build a cohesive kitchen design that endures the test of time, rendering it an inviting space for cooking adventures and family celebrations alike.
Budget Strategies for Your Kitchen Renovation Initiative
Designing a beautiful kitchen using long-lasting materials often requires careful budget management. To begin, homeowners should set a practical budget that covers all aspects of the remodel, such as materials, labor, and unforeseen expenses. It is advisable to set aside 10-20% of the total budget for emergencies, guaranteeing flexibility for unexpected costs.
Comparing costs from multiple suppliers can uncover the best deals, while focusing on key characteristics helps maintain focus. Selecting moderate-quality materials can strike a balance between excellence and cost, enabling for aesthetic appeal without exceeding budget.
Homeowners should also consider do-it-yourself alternatives for specific projects, such as painting or installing hardware, to save on labor costs. Additionally, exploring financing options, such as home equity lines of credit or unsecured personal loans, can provide required capital while maintaining a reasonable payment schedule. Careful planning and strategic choices can convert a vision into reality without monetary pressure.
